Thanks to the sensor, X-H2S has dramatically improved performance, including 40fps blackout-free burst shooting and significantly better AF during burst shooting. As for video, X-H2S can record 4K\/60P video without cropping and rolling-shutter effect is also greatly improved.<\/p>\n<\/p><\/div>\n<\/p><\/div>\n<div class=\"top-xProcessor__mediaImage js_parallax s_parallaxY\"><img decoding=\"async\" src=\"\/products-cameras-static\/x-trans-cmos\/assets\/images\/top\/jyzc_xProcessor_img_01.png?220517\" alt=\"\"><\/div>\n<\/p><\/div>\n<div class=\"top-xProcessor__media s_reverse\">\n<div class=\"top-xProcessor__mediaContents js_parallax s_parallaxY\">\n<h3 class=\"top-xProcessor__mediaTitle\">Stacked layer structure<\/h3>\n<div class=\"top-xProcessor__mediaText\">\n<p>By placing the chips that process and read out signals on the back of the sensor surface, the reading speed is more than 4 times faster than the previous model and more than 30 times faster than the first-generation model.  By taking advantage of the fast read speed, it is possible to process the focusing signal while processing the image for display. And this sensor has an improved pixel structure, allowing light to be received more efficiently.
